1 INDICATIONS AND USAGE XELJANZ (tablets and oral solution) and XELJANZ XR (extended release tablets) are Janus kinase (JAK) inhibitors. XELJANZ tablets and XELJANZ XR are indicated for the treatment of adult patients with: Moderately to severely active rheumatoid arthritis (RA), who have had an inadequate response or intolerance to one or more TNF blockers.

Dosage Information

2 DOSAGE AND ADMINISTRATION Recommended Evaluations and Immunization Prior to Treatment Initiation • Prior to initiating XELJANZ/XELJANZ XR, consider performing an active and latent TB evaluation, viral hepatitis screening, a complete blood count, and updating immunizations.
